This flute offers the advanced student or serious amateur flautist a beautifully rich, yet solid tone with excellent mechanics. This hand-finished instrument would be ideal as a 2nd or 3rd flute, due to the improved tonal depth and interest provided by the 3K gold lip plate and solid .925 sterling silver head joint.
Pearl’s Dolce series flutes are built in the same moulds as the professional 795 Elegante instruments, and expertly demonstrate Pearl’s commitment to accuracy of pitch and flexible articulation.
The key work is made from a heavier gauge metal and is more finely sculpted than Pearl’s student and 665 Quantz series. Also, the Forza head joint produces unbelievable projection combined with a dazzling rich tone.
This flute comes with a B foot joint as standard. This extends the instruments range to low B which is invaluable for orchestral music and advanced solo pieces. Furthermore, the extra weight of this foot joint blackens the tone and increase resistance in the higher registers ever so slightly. This instrument also features a C# trill key to facilitate B to C# trills, and a D# roller which enables movement between the C, C# and D# keys on the foot joint.
This particular instrument has open holes (French or Ring keys) through the middle of keys A, G, F, E and D. This feature is particularly useful for extended techniques (such as quarter-tones and note slides), as well as encouraging an accurate hand position.
Like all Pearl flutes, their exclusive pinless mechanism is at the heart of the mechanics of this instrument. This design feature significantly reduces the levels of perspiration and body acid that can enter the mechanism, which almost eliminates the corrosion and binding of keys.
This instrument also comes with French pointed key-arms, which means that the key-arms run all the way into the centre of the keys, combining elegance with strength, stability and speed.
In addition, this flute has a one-piece core-bar construction, which results in an extremely reliable mechanism that plays more comfortably, stays in adjustment, and is far easier to service than traditionally constructed flutes!
